Bharti Airtel to offer Bajaj Finance’s loan products at its app, later at stores

[ad_1] Telecom major Bharti Airtel is set to offer non-banking lender Bajaj Finance’s financial products in India, the companies said on Monday, reported Reuters. At the start, Airtel will offer Bajaj Finance’s products through its mobile application, and later through its physical stores, both the companies said in a joint statement. Telecom minister Scindia launches new initiatives for consumers; 1100 Mhz spectrum to be refarmed

[ad_1] Telecom minister Jyotiraditya Scindia launched three initiatives including the National Broadband Mission 2.0 and the Sanchar Saathi mobile app, aimed at improving connectivity and consumer convenience. New quality norms to raise compliance burden, costs for telecom firms: COAI

[ad_1] India’s telecom service providers on Sunday said they were disappointed with the regulator’s new quality of service (QoS) norms, as the compliance burden and associated costs will increase substantially without commensurate benefits to consumers.
